Outdoor Free Date Ideas

When it comes to date nights, outdoor activities can be a great way to spend time together without breaking the bank. Whether you're looking for a romantic picnic or an adventurous hike, there are plenty of options for outdoor free date ideas. Here are some ideas to get you started:

Picnic Dates

Having a picnic in the park is a classic and romantic date idea that never gets old. All you need is a blanket, some food, and good company. Pack a basket with your favorite snacks and drinks, and find a quiet spot in your local park to enjoy each other's company. If you're feeling adventurous, you can even make a game out of it by going on a picnic scavenger hunt.

Nature Exploration

Going for a hike or a walk in the park can be a great way to explore nature and get some exercise at the same time. Look up some local hiking trails or parks in your area and plan a date around exploring the great outdoors. You can even make a bucket list of all the parks and trails you want to visit together.

Beach and Park Dates

If you live near the beach, a walk on the beach at sunset can be a romantic and memorable date idea. You can also have a picnic on the beach or go for a bike ride along the shore. If you don't live near the beach, a local park can be just as romantic. Go for a run, play frisbee, or even try your hand at fishing. And if you're lucky enough to live near a park with a clear view of the night sky, stargazing can be a magical and romantic way to spend the evening.

No matter what outdoor activity you choose, the key is to enjoy each other's company and have fun exploring the world around you. So get out there and make some memories together!

Indoor Free Date Ideas

When it comes to dating, you don't always have to spend a lot of money to have a good time. There are plenty of cheap or free indoor date ideas that you can enjoy with your significant other. Here are some ideas that you can try out:

Home Based Dates

Spending time at home can be just as romantic and fun as going out. You can create a cozy atmosphere by lighting candles, playing music, and cooking a meal together. Here are some home-based date ideas:

  • Game Night: Have a game night with your partner. You can play video games, cards, or board games. This is a great way to bond and have some friendly competition.
  • Spa Night: Create a spa night at home. You can give each other massages, do face masks, and relax together.
  • Scavenger Hunt: Create a scavenger hunt for your partner. You can hide clues around the house and have them lead to a surprise at the end.
  • Movie Marathon: Have a movie marathon with your partner. Pick a theme, such as romantic comedies or horror movies, and snuggle up on the couch.
  • DIY Project: Work on a DIY project together. This can be anything from painting a room to building a piece of furniture.
  • Love Letters: Write love letters to each other. This is a great way to express your feelings and strengthen your bond.

Library and Museum Dates

Going to a library or museum can be a great way to spend time together and learn something new. Many libraries and museums offer free admission or have discounted rates. Here are some ideas:

  • Author Reading: Attend an author reading at a local library or bookstore. This is a great way to discover new authors and books.
  • Art Museum: Visit an art museum and admire the artwork together. Many museums offer free admission on certain days or times.
  • Museums: Visit a museum that interests both of you. This can be a history museum, science museum, or any other type of museum.
  • Puzzle: Work on a puzzle together. You can find puzzles at many libraries or museums, or bring your own.

These are just a few ideas for cheap or free indoor date ideas. Remember, it's not about how much money you spend, but the quality time you spend together that matters.

Volunteer and Community Date Ideas

If you and your significant other are looking for a way to give back to your community and spend quality time together, volunteering is a great option. Not only does it allow you to make a positive impact, but it can also be a fun and unique date idea.

Animal Shelter Dates

Many animal shelters rely on volunteers to help care for their animals, and volunteering together can be a great way to bond over your shared love of animals. You can help with tasks such as walking dogs, cleaning cages, and socializing with cats. Some shelters even offer volunteer orientations and training sessions to help you get started.

Community Event Dates

Volunteering at a community event is another great way to give back while spending time together. Look for free concerts, festivals, or other events in your area that need volunteers. You might help with tasks such as setting up and taking down equipment, checking tickets, or directing attendees. Volunteering at a community event can be a fun way to meet new people while making a difference.

No matter what type of volunteering you choose, it's important to find an organization or cause that you both feel passionate about. This will make the experience more enjoyable and fulfilling for both of you. Additionally, volunteering together can help strengthen your relationship by giving you a shared sense of purpose and accomplishment.

Overall, volunteering is a great way to spend time with your significant other while giving back to your community. Whether you choose to volunteer at an animal shelter or a community event, you're sure to have a memorable and rewarding experience.

Affordable Date Ideas

Dating doesn't have to break the bank. In fact, some of the best dates can be affordable or even free. Check out these budget-friendly date ideas that won't leave you feeling broke.

Budget Friendly Outdoor Dates

  1. Go for a walk or hike - Enjoy some fresh air and exercise while exploring nature. Many parks and trails are free to visit, making this a great option for a budget-friendly date.
  2. Picnic in the park - Pack a blanket and some snacks and head to a local park for a romantic picnic. You can even bring your own food from home to save money.
  3. Visit a zoo or aquarium - Many zoos and aquariums offer discounted admission on certain days of the week, making it an affordable date option.
  4. Attend a street fair or farmer's market - Check your local events calendar for street fairs or farmer's markets. You can enjoy live music, food, and browse local goods without spending a lot of money.

Budget Friendly Indoor Dates

  1. Game night - Stay in and have a game night with your date. You can play board games, card games, or video games for a fun and affordable date night.
  2. Happy hour - Many bars and restaurants offer happy hour specials on food and drinks, making it an affordable option for a night out.
  3. Visit a dive bar - Check out a local dive bar for a low-key night out. You can enjoy cheap drinks and a relaxed atmosphere.
  4. Visit an arcade or bowling alley - Many arcades and bowling alleys offer discounted rates on certain days of the week, making it an affordable date option.
  5. Cook a candlelit dinner at home - You can save money by cooking a romantic dinner at home instead of going out to a fancy restaurant.
  6. Attend a comedy club - Many comedy clubs offer affordable tickets for stand-up comedy shows.
  7. Visit a brewery or food truck festival - Check your local events calendar for brewery or food truck festivals. You can enjoy local food and drinks without spending a lot of money.
  8. Watch a movie at a drive-in theater - Drive-in theaters often offer double features for the price of one movie ticket, making it an affordable date option.

Remember, dating doesn't have to be expensive. By being creative and thinking outside the box, you can plan a fun and affordable date that won't break the bank. As inflation continues to rise, it's important to find affordable date ideas that fit your budget.
